
The conference “People-centered smart cities” will take place on Wednesday 2nd of February 2022 at the Regional Council of the Greater East Region in Strasbourg, France.
Facing digital challenges, French stakeholders are committed to get involved in an international and partnership program which aims to adress local and global challenges on digital, as to fancy the opportunities it represents for sustainable and inclusive cities.
Since the launching of the UN-Habitat flagship program, the French Ministry of Europe and Foreign Affairs and the Greater East Region, with the coordination of the Fnau (French network of urban planning agencies) and their partners, are preparing the French contribution to the program of UN-Habitat on “People-centered smart cities”, including this conference. This contribution takes also part of the European Union commitments to implement the digital transformation of Europe by 2030.
The conference of Strasbourg will be the opportunity to gather French, European and international highlevel stakeholders to debate during roundtables on the challenges of new practices, inclusion, sobriety and governance.
